Transaction 6669373409442457b9187133316e49714b6982c72a8aac74bff95751d3d45328
1 Input
1 Output
-
6669373409442457b9187133316e49714b6982c72a8aac74bff95751d3d45328:0
- value
- 358587
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ea3eb67695765b4120dd1f0155165a4144a64f87316f856b8ece004f94776f2d
- address
- bc1pagltva54wed5zgxaruq429j6g9z2vnu8x9hc26uwecqyl9rhduks858hgf